Thixomolding



How it works

1. chips of magnesium allow are fed into a heated screw and barrel assembly where an argon shield prevents the material from oxidizing
2. as the screw rotates inside the barrel, the magnesium is conveyed forward and heated to between 1040 – 1166F (560 – 630C), where it forms a semi-solid slurry
3. the semi-solid magnesium allow is injected into the mold at a high speed
4. the viscocity of the allow is reduced due to the materials thixotropic state, and it can therefore flow into the desired form with higher precision than casting and forging

Advantages
easily automated and controlled
high production rate
smooth filling of the die
low shrinkage porosity
lower melting temperature
higher dimensional accuracy
highly complex shapes
enhanced component properties
achieve very thin walls
